K.W. Lee, a pioneering Asian American journalist, passed away at 96 in Sacramento. His reporting led to the release of a Korean immigrant on death row and covered the Koreatown community during the 1992 Los Angeles riots. Lee’s work in mainstream and ethnic press highlighted injustice, corruption, and racial tensions, uniting Asian American communities and advocating for social change.

Fortitude Gold (FTCO) Q2 Sales Down 49%
Fortitude Gold (OTC:FTCO) reported Q2 2025 earnings on August 5, revealing GAAP revenue of $4.9 million and earnings per share of $0.04, a 49% decline in sales from Q2 2024 due to lower production at the Isabella Pearl mine. Despite operational challenges, the company achieved a net income of $0.8 million, focusing on cost management and regulatory compliance while preparing for its next project, County Line.
